Tokyo's Trendy New Cafe: Grannies & Grandpas Serve Tea

A new cafe in Tokyo's Shibuya district is staffed by seniors with an average age of 73. G-cha and Ba-cha offers a unique tea experience with a modern twist, blending traditional flavors with innovative service.

Miso Cookie Pie: New Japanese Dessert!

Discover a unique Japanese dessert: miso cookie pie! This no-cream bake uses "kōji" mold for a delicious, seasonal treat.

Japan Dept. Store Duty-Free Sales Rebound

Duty-free sales in Japanese department stores are recovering after a slump. This is largely due to easing tensions and increased spending from Chinese tourists.

Hong Kong Fuel Crackdown Amid Iran Tensions

Hong Kong is battling fuel smuggling as tensions in Iran impact global oil prices. This crackdown comes as lawmakers seek solutions, potentially impacting transportation costs.
